To facilitate the movie recording, it is recommended to use a memory card that supports faster write speed.
(Write speed: 1.25 MB / sec or higher) If you use a low write-speed memory card, recording may stop with
a message of "Low speed card. Please record at lower quality".
If you inevitably use a low speed card, select a lower quality ("Fine"
→
"Normal") or set the movie size to
352p.
Memory cards of bigger than 8GB in capacity may not work properly.
The memory card that is used to store a movie can cause unwritable area, which may result in reduced
recording time and free memory space.
The maximum size of a movie (MPEG4) file that can be recorded at one time is 2GB.
You can store up to 5000 movie images on a memory card.
Movie image files recorded on other equipment are not playable on this memory camcorder.
